一种语音通讯方法及装置、系统制造方法及图纸

技术编号:10598376 阅读:124 留言:0更新日期:2014-10-30 11:47
本发明专利技术实施例公开了一种语音通讯方法及装置、系统,该方法包括:接收主叫终端用户对即时通讯界面进行操作触发的被叫终端用户呼叫请求;响应被叫终端用户呼叫请求,获取被叫终端用户的标识信息;将被叫终端用户的标识信息发送给即时通讯服务器,使即时通讯服务器将被叫终端用户的标识信息发送给电话交换网络中的服务控制点,由该服务控制点将被叫终端用户的标识信息映射为被叫终端用户的IP地址和端口号,并由该服务控制点向被叫终端用户的IP地址和端口号发起呼叫请求,以建立主叫终端用户与被叫终端用户的语音通讯。能够实现登录即时通讯服务器的主叫终端用户与无法登录即时通讯服务器的被叫终端用户通过即时通讯服务器进行语音通讯。

【技术实现步骤摘要】
一种语音通讯方法及装置、系统
本专利技术涉及通讯
,具体涉及一种语音通讯方法及装置、系统。
技术介绍
即时通讯(InstantMessenger,IM)是一种基于互联网的通讯服务,即时通讯可以实现通讯双方之间的文字、语音、视频、文件等信息的交流与互动。通常地,主叫终端用户在主叫终端上利用账号信息登录即时通讯服务器之后,主叫终端用户可以和已登录即时通讯服务器的被叫终端用户进行语音通讯,从而可以有效节省通讯双方的经济成本。然而实践中发现,上述语音通讯方法要求主叫终端和被叫终端均能登录即时通讯服务器,而对于老人手机等无法登录即时通讯服务器的被叫终端而言,主叫终端即使登录了即时通讯服务器也无法通过即时通讯服务器与被叫终端进行语音通讯。
技术实现思路
本专利技术实施例公开了一种语音通讯方法及装置、系统,能够实现登录即时通讯服务器的主叫终端用户与无法登录即时通讯服务器的被叫终端用户通过即时通讯服务器进行语音通讯。本专利技术实施例第一方面公开了一种语音通讯方法,包括:接收主叫终端用户对即时通讯界面进行操作触发的被叫终端用户呼叫请求;响应所述被叫终端用户呼叫请求,并获取所述被叫终端用户的标识信息;将所述被叫终端用户的标识信息发送给即时通讯服务器,使所述即时通讯服务器将所述被叫终端用户的标识信息发送给电话交换网络中的服务控制点(ServiceControlPoint,SCP),由所述服务控制点将所述被叫终端用户的标识信息映射为所述被叫终端用户的IP地址和端口号,并由所述服务控制点向所述被叫终端用户的IP地址和端口号发起呼叫请求,以建立所述主叫终端用户与所述被叫终端用户的语音通讯。本专利技术实施例第二方面公开了一种语音通讯方法,包括:主叫终端接收主叫终端用户对即时通讯界面进行操作触发的被叫终端用户呼叫请求,并响应所述被叫终端用户呼叫请求,获取所述被叫终端用户的标识信息;以及,将所述被叫终端用户的标识信息发送给即时通讯服务器;所述即时通讯服务器将所述被叫终端用户的标识信息发送给电话交换网络中的服务控制点;所述服务控制点将所述被叫终端用户的标识信息映射为所述被叫终端用户的IP地址和端口号,并向所述被叫终端用户的IP地址和端口号发起呼叫请求;所述被叫终端接收所述服务控制点发送呼叫请求,以建立所述主叫终端用户与所述被叫终端用户的语音通讯。本专利技术实施例第三方面公开了一种语音通讯装置,包括:接收单元,用于接收主叫终端用户对即时通讯界面进行操作触发的被叫终端用户呼叫请求;第一响应获取单元,用于响应所述被叫终端用户呼叫请求,并获取所述被叫终端用户的标识信息;发送单元,用于将所述被叫终端用户的标识信息发送给即时通讯服务器,使所述即时通讯服务器将所述被叫终端用户的标识信息发送给电话交换网络中的服务控制点,由所述服务控制点将所述被叫终端用户的标识信息映射为所述被叫终端用户的IP地址和端口号,并由所述服务控制点向所述被叫终端用户的IP地址和端口号发起呼叫请求,以建立所述主叫终端用户与所述被叫终端用户的语音通讯。本专利技术实施例第四方面公开了一种语音通讯系统,包括主叫终端、即时通讯服务器、电话交换网络中的服务控制点以及被叫终端,其中:所述主叫终端,用于接收主叫终端用户对即时通讯界面进行操作触发的被叫终端用户呼叫请求,并响应所述被叫终端用户呼叫请求,获取所述被叫终端用户的标识信息;以及,将所述被叫终端用户的标识信息发送给所述即时通讯服务器;所述即时通讯服务器,用于将所述被叫终端用户的标识信息发送给所述电话交换网络中的服务控制点;所述服务控制点,用于将所述被叫终端用户的标识信息映射为所述被叫终端用户的IP地址和端口号,并向所述被叫终端用户的IP地址和端口号发起呼叫请求;所述被叫终端,用于接收所述服务控制点发送呼叫请求,以建立所述主叫终端用户与所述被叫终端用户的语音通讯。本专利技术实施例中,主叫终端接收到主叫终端用户对即时通讯界面进行操作触发的被叫终端用户呼叫请求后,可以获取被叫终端用户的标识信息并发送给即时通讯服务器,由即时通讯服务器将被叫终端用户的标识信息发送给电话交换网络中的服务控制点(SCP),使得服务控制点将被叫终端用户的标识信息映射为被叫终端用户的IP地址和端口号后,向被叫终端用户的IP地址和端口号发起呼叫请求,从而建立主叫终端用户与被叫终端用户的语音通讯。通过实施本专利技术,可以实现登录即时通讯服务器的主叫终端用户与无法登录即时通讯服务器的被叫终端用户通过即时通讯服务器进行语音通讯,本专利技术具有较强的实用性,具有很大的市场潜力。附图说明为了更清楚地说明本专利技术实施例中的技术方案,下面将对实施例中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1是本专利技术实施例公开的一种语音通讯方法的流程图;图2是本专利技术实施例公开的另一种语音通讯方法的流程图;图3是本专利技术实施例公开的一种语音通讯装置的结构图;图4是本专利技术实施例公开的一种语音通讯系统的结构图。具体实施方式下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。本专利技术实施例公开了一种语音通讯方法及装置、系统,能够实现登录即时通讯服务器的主叫终端用户与无法登录即时通讯服务器的被叫终端用户通过即时通讯服务器进行语音通讯,具有较强的实用性,具有很大的市场潜力。以下分别进行详细说明。请参阅图1,图1是本专利技术实施例公开的一种语音通讯方法的流程图。其中,图1所描述的语音通讯方法是从主叫终端一侧来进行说明的。本专利技术实施例中,主叫终端可以包括运行安卓(Android)系统或iOS系统的移动手机、平板电脑等,其中,在主叫终端上,主叫终端用户可以利用账号信息来登录即时通讯服务器。如图1所示,该语音通讯方法可以包括以下步骤。S101、主叫终端接收主叫终端用户对即时通讯界面进行操作触发的被叫终端用户呼叫请求。本专利技术实施例中,主叫终端用户在主叫终端上利用账号信息登录即时通讯服务器之后,主叫终端可以接收主叫终端用户对即时通讯界面上显示的被叫终端用户对应的呼叫请求标识进行操作触发的被叫终端用户呼叫请求。举例来说,主叫终端用户可以通过单击方式对即时通讯界面上显示的被叫终端用户对应的呼叫请求标识进行操作,从而触发被叫终端用户呼叫请求,使得主叫终端可以接收该被叫终端用户呼叫请求。S102、主叫终端响应被叫终端用户呼叫请求,获取被叫终端用户的标识信息。本专利技术实施例中,被叫终端用户的标识信息可以包括被叫终端的国际移动用户识别码(InternationalMobileSubscriberIdentificationNumber,IMSI)或被叫终端的介质访问控制(Medium/MediaAccessControl,MAC)地址等,本专利技术实施例不作限定。S103、主叫终端将被叫终端用户的标识信息发送给即时通讯服务器,使即时通讯服务器将被叫终端用户的标识信息发送给电话交换网络中的SCP,由SCP将被叫终端用户的标识信息映射为被叫终本文档来自技高网...
一种语音通讯方法及装置、系统

【技术保护点】
一种语音通讯方法,其特征在于,包括:接收主叫终端用户对即时通讯界面进行操作触发的被叫终端用户呼叫请求;响应所述被叫终端用户呼叫请求,获取所述被叫终端用户的标识信息;将所述被叫终端用户的标识信息发送给即时通讯服务器,使所述即时通讯服务器将所述被叫终端用户的标识信息发送给电话交换网络中的服务控制点,由所述服务控制点将所述被叫终端用户的标识信息映射为所述被叫终端用户的IP地址和端口号,并由所述服务控制点向所述被叫终端用户的IP地址和端口号发起呼叫请求,以建立所述主叫终端用户与所述被叫终端用户的语音通讯。

【技术特征摘要】
1.一种语音通讯方法,其特征在于,包括:在主叫终端利用账号信息登录即时通讯服务器之后,接收主叫终端用户对即时通讯界面进行操作触发的被叫终端用户呼叫请求;响应所述被叫终端用户呼叫请求,获取所述被叫终端用户的标识信息;将所述被叫终端用户的标识信息发送给即时通讯服务器,使所述即时通讯服务器将所述被叫终端用户的标识信息发送给电话交换网络中的服务控制点,由所述服务控制点将所述被叫终端用户的标识信息映射为所述被叫终端用户的IP地址和端口号,并由所述服务控制点向所述被叫终端用户的IP地址和端口号发起呼叫请求,以建立所述主叫终端用户与所述被叫终端用户的语音通讯,其中,所述被叫终端用户的标识信息包括被叫终端的国际移动用户识别码或被叫终端的介质访问控制地址。2.根据权利要求1所述的语音通讯方法,其特征在于,所述接收主叫终端用户对即时通讯界面进行操作触发的被叫终端用户呼叫请求之前,所述方法还包括:响应主叫终端用户触发的扫描指令,扫描被叫终端用户的二维码,获得所述被叫终端用户的标识信息;保存获得的所述被叫终端用户的标识信息;以及,生成所述被叫终端用户对应的呼叫请求标识,并通过即时通讯界面显示所述被叫终端用户对应的呼叫请求标识。3.根据权利要求2所述的语音通讯方法,其特征在于,所述接收主叫终端用户对即时通讯界面进行操作触发的被叫终端用户呼叫请求包括:接收主叫终端用户对所述即时通讯界面上显示的被叫终端用户对应的呼叫请求标识进行操作触发的被叫终端用户呼叫请求。4.根据权利要求1、2或3所述的语音通讯方法,其特征在于,所述服务控制点向所述被叫终端用户的IP地址和端口号发起呼叫请求之前,所述服务控制点还查询所述被叫终端用户的在线状态,若所述被叫终端用户处于在线待接续状态,则所述服务控制点执行所述的向所述被叫终端用户的IP地址和端口号发起呼叫请求的步骤。5.根据权利要求4所述的语音通讯方法,其特征在于,若所述被叫终端用户不处于在线待接续状态,则由所述服务控制点发送被叫终端用户不在线信息给所述即时通讯服务器,所述方法还包括:接收所述即时通讯服务器发送的所述被叫终端用户不在线信息。6.一种语音通讯方法,其特征在于,包括:在主叫终端利用账号信息登录即时通讯服务器之后,主叫终端接收主叫终端用户对即时通讯界面进行操作触发的被叫终端用户呼叫请求,并响应所述被叫终端用户呼叫请求,获取所述被叫终端用户的标识信息;以及,将所述被叫终端用户的标识信息发送给即时通讯服务器;所述即时通讯服务器将所述被叫终端用户的标识信息发送给电话交换网络中的服务控制点;所述服务控制点将所述被叫终端用户的标识信息映射为所述被叫终端用户的IP地址和端口号,并向所述被叫终端用户的IP地址和端口号发起呼叫请求;所述被叫终端接收所述服务控制点发送呼叫请求,以建立所述主叫终端用户与所述被叫终端用户的语音通讯;其中,所述被叫终端用户的标识信息包括被叫终端的国际移动用户识别码或被叫终端的介质访问控制地址。7.根据权利要求6所述的语音通讯方法,其特征在于,所述主叫终端接收主叫终端用户对即时通讯界面进行操作触发的被叫终端用户呼叫请求之前,所述方法还包括:主叫终端响应主叫终端用户触发的扫描指令,扫描被叫终端用户的二维码,获得所述被叫终端用户的标识信息;所述主叫终端保存获得的所述被叫终端用户的标识信息;以及,所述主叫终端生成所述被叫终端用户对应的呼叫请求标识,并通过即时通讯界面显示所述被叫终端用户对应的呼叫请求标识。8.根据权利要求7所述的语音通讯方法,其特征在于,所述主叫终端接收主叫终端用户对即时通讯界面进行操作触发的被叫终端用户呼叫请求包括:主叫终端接收主叫终端用户对所述即时通讯界面上显示的被叫终端用户对应的呼叫请求标识进行操作触发的被叫终端用户呼叫请求。9.根据权利要求6、7或8所述的语音通讯方法,其特征在于,所述服务控制点向所述被叫终端用户的IP地址和端口号发起呼叫请求之前,所述服务控制点还查询所述被叫终端用户的在线状态,若所述被叫终端用户处于在线待接续状态,则所述服务控制点执行所述的向所述被叫终端用户的IP地址和端口号发起呼叫请求的步骤。10.根据权利要求9所述的语音通讯方法,其特征在于,若所述被叫终端用户不处于在线待接续状态,所述方法还包括:所述服务控制点发送被叫终端用户不在线信息给所述即时通讯服务器;所述即时通讯服务器接收所述服务控制点发送的所述被叫终端用户不在线信息,并发送给所述主叫终端;所述主叫终端接收所述即时通讯服务器发送的所述被叫终端用户不在线信息。11.一种语音通讯装置,其特征在于,包括:接收单元,用于在主叫终端利用账号信息登录即时...

【专利技术属性】
技术研发人员:张斌刘乐君刘凯刘金海范亮亮刘呈林翁乐腾朱亚玄何庆张月馨林津陈岳伟林倩雅李凯单祎
申请(专利权)人:腾讯科技深圳有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1